Ingredients

  • 1/3 cup Bailey’s Irish Cream
  • 1/3 cup milk
  • 1/3 cup whipping/thickened cream
  • 2/3 cup dark chocolate chips
  • pinch of salt

Preparation

Place all the ingredients in a  small saucepan and heat on low until the chocolate is melted. Cook a little longer if you desire a slightly thicker sauce.

Serve over good vanilla ice cream and decorate with sprinkles if you so desire.
